Job Description

Job Location: This position is based onsite in Atlanta, GA. Candidates must be located in the Atlanta metro area and be able to commute to the Artera office. Relocation assistance is not offered.

Job Summary: The Cyber Security Engineer is a key member of the IT Security team, responsible for day-to-day security operations, security tooling management, and advancing Artera’s cybersecurity maturity across cloud and on‑premises environments. This role monitors and responds to internal and external security threats, performs in‑depth technical analysis, and leads remediation efforts to restore and maintain secure business operations. This position plays a critical role in reducing risk to the organization and our customers by safeguarding Artera’s systems, applications, and data.

Job Responsibilities:

Security Architecture & Design

  • Lead architecting and implementing cybersecurity solutions across cloud and on-premises environments
  • Maintain secure configurations for systems, networks, and applications in alignment with industry standards (CIS Benchmarks, NIST, ISO 27001)
  • Conduct security architecture reviews and risk assessments of third-party systems and applications
  • Support the development and enforcement of enterprise security policies, standards, and access controls

Security Operations & Incident Management

  • Coordinate security operations efforts with IT Operations to remediate vulnerabilities and reduce operational risk
  • Lead technical investigation and response for high‑severity security incidents, including alerts from Microsoft Defender, Microsoft 365 Security Center, and Microsoft Defender for Cloud Apps (CAS)
  • Stay current with emerging threats, vulnerabilities, and security technologies to continuously evolve defense mechanisms
  • Engineer, deploy, and maintain security tooling and endpoint protection platforms
  • Develop and automate processes for vulnerability detection, remediation, and compliance reporting, leveraging Microsoft security solutions and other enterprise tools
  • Partner with IT and Dev Ops teams to integrate security into CI/CD pipelines, infrastructure‑as‑code (IaC), and application development workflows

Documentation, Governance & Mentorship

  • Create and maintain technical documentation, architectural diagrams, and incident response playbooks
  • Contribute to security governance initiatives, audits, and risk assessments as needed
  • Provide technical mentorship and guidance to junior analysts or engineers
Basic Qualifications:
  • 5+ years of experience in cybersecurity engineering, security operations, or infrastructure security
  • Bachelor’s degree in Cybersecurity, Computer Engineering, Information Systems, or related field preferred, or equivalent practical experience
  • Industry certifications such as Security certifications (AZ‑500, SC‑200, CISSP, GIAC, etc.)
  • Ability to lead incident response and communicate effectively during high‑severity events
  • Strong understanding of security frameworks (NIST, CIS, ISO 27001)
  • Expertise in endpoint security tools, vulnerability management systems (e.g., Qualys, Tenable), and SIEMs (e.g., Sentinel, Splunk)
  • Proficiency in scripting languages (e.g., Power Shell, Python, or Bash) for automation
  • Solid understanding of network protocols, security controls, and secure system administration (Windows/Linux/Mac)
